## Session Handling — Pointsledger Plugin API

Plugins interacting with the Pointsledger loyalty ledger must maintain a session per tenant. Sessions expire after thirty minutes of inactivity, and all balance mutations within a session are atomic on commit. Never share sessions across tenants. To open a session against the Willowmere sandbox ledger, authenticate using the token below.

login token, kagaf-bawig: eyJhbGciOiJIUzI1NiIsInR5cCI6IkpXVCJ9.eyJzdWIiOiI1b8bmcIn0.xjc0uBP3

# Onboarding — Plotfill Address Widget

Welcome to the on-call rotation for Plotfill, our address autocomplete widget served from the Kestrelport edge cluster. Most pages you'll see are caused by the suggestion backend rejecting requests with an expired credential. Before you can run the staging harness or rotate anything, you need a working local environment. Create a `.env` file and add exactly this line:

sealed setting: ARCHIVE_KEY3=8d0

**Action Item: Contrast Audit Follow-up.** Several Quillbox settings panels failed the contrast audit — disabled buttons and muted labels were the worst offenders. Fix tokens, not individual components. Use the Lintfern token set only; no hardcoded hex values. Re-run the audit script after each batch and attach results to the tracking ticket. Deadline: end of sprint. The audit spreadsheet, token mapping table, and sign-off process live on the page below.

dashboard of yahaf-kajep = https://jira.zemvarsys.internal/display/projects/browse/browse/a08b

## Tuning

We're upgrading the Larkmill broker from the 3.x line to 5.0, which changes default queue depths and ack timeouts. Before touching staging, read the migration notes in docs/broker-upgrade.md and confirm the consumer fleet is on the new client library. The constants below are the values we settled on after load testing, and they should be applied verbatim.

tuning constants:
TIERS = {
    "sorion": 670,
    "istax": 547,
}